Cutting-edge Therapeutic Modalities


In recent years, dermatological therapeutics has witnessed a remarkable evolution with the introduction of innovative treatment modalities that aim to enhance patient outcomes and reduce side effects. One of the most notable developments is the use of biological therapies, which target particular pathways involved in skin diseases. These treatments have shown impressive efficacy in conditions such as psoriasis and atopic dermatitis, providing improvement for patients who have not responded adequately to conventional therapies.


Another encouraging approach includes the use of state-of-the-art laser technologies and light-based treatments. These modalities are being employed for a variety of skin issues, ranging from acne scars to rosacea and pigmentation issues. The precision of laser therapies allows for targeted treatment with minimal impact on surrounding tissues, resulting in quicker recovery times and enhanced cosmetic results. As technology continues to progress, these devices are becoming more accessible, making them a viable option for a broader variety of patients.


Moreover, the incorporation of regenerative medicine into dermatological treatments is gaining traction. Techniques such as platelet-rich plasma injections and stem cell therapies are under investigation for their potential to promote healing and rejuvenation of the skin. These methods harness the body’s own healing mechanisms, offering a more comprehensive approach to treatment. As research continues to unveil the benefits of regenerative modalities, they are likely to become a standard in the management of multiple dermatological issues.


Innovative Investigations and Advancements


The area of dermatological therapeutics is undergoing rapid advancements as scientists examine creative therapeutic strategies. One key sector of focus is the creation of biotech therapies that target specific pathways involved in dermal disorders. These interventions have demonstrated promise in addressing diseases such as psoriasis and eczema, offering individuals more tailored and customized care. As understanding of the immunology and dermal biology expands, the potential for custom treatments is turning into a reality, lowering adverse effects and boosting care.


Another significant advancement is the integration of telehealth in skin practice. Remote consultations have emerged as a feasible alternative for many individuals, permitting for timely review and care of dermal conditions without the requirement for face-to-face consults. This transition not only boosts reach but also improves the ability to track therapy progress and adapt interventions as needed. The integration of cutting-edge imaging and artificial intelligence in teledermatology is further improving assessment, helping dermatologists to identify and manage issues more promptly and more accurately.


Lastly, the study of gene-based treatments holds game-changing capability for treating hereditary skin disorders. Researchers are examining the complexities of genome editing techniques, such as gene modulation, to provide durable answers for diseases that have before now been difficult to address. Initial trials are proving the possibility of repairing genetic mutations at the root, opening pathways for groundbreaking treatments that could fundamentally change the landscape of dermato-therapeutic care, offering possibilities to those impacted by crippling hereditary skin conditions.


Patient-Focused Approaches in Skin Care


The integration of patient-centered strategies in dermatology is crucial for improving treatment outcomes and enhancing patient happiness. Understanding that each individual has specific requirements and preferences allows skin care specialists to adapt therapies accordingly. Incorporating patients in the treatment planning process not only motivates them but also cultivates a collaborative environment where their issues and needs are prioritized.


Communication plays a crucial role in this approach. Skin care professionals should create transparent lines of dialogue, ensuring that patients feel safe discussing their health issues and treatment options. By actively listening to patients and addressing their queries, dermatologists can build trust and rapport. This engagement encourages compliance to treatment plans and enables improved management of long-term skin conditions, which often require continuous care and modification of therapies.


Moreover, considering the mental and emotional aspects of skin diseases is vital.
